KOLC Inc. (Toshima-ku, Tokyo; CEO: Masao Tsutsumi) has significantly enhanced the 'Mapping Function' for creating 3D and 2D CAD from point cloud data within its BIM/CIM cloud service 'KOLC+'. This allows users to perform 3D mapping tasks smoothly and intuitively using only a web browser, without requiring high-spec PCs or installed CAD software.

## Development Background
As Infrastructure DX and mandatory BIM/CIM application expand, the use of point cloud data from drones and laser scanners is rapidly increasing. However, mapping point clouds into lines and surfaces typically requires high processing power and expensive specialized workstations. KOLC+ leverages its cloud strength to solve these issues with practical new features.

## Key Update Features

### Support for Edit History (Undo/Redo)
The system now supports Undo/Redo (Ctrl+Z / Ctrl+Y). This enables stress-free trial and error, improving overall work efficiency.

### Enhanced Input Assist (Rectangle / 90° / XY Axis)
- **Rectangle Input**: Quickly and accurately enter rectangular shapes like walls or foundations by specifying three points.
- **90-Degree Snap**: Maintain precise right angles while modeling structure corners.
- **XY Axis Snap**: Draw lines accurately along the X and Y coordinate axes.

### Dimension Input Support
In addition to manual plotting, users can now enter specific numerical dimensions to create and edit shapes based on design or measured values.

### Color Preservation for DXF Export
When exporting mapped data as DXF, specified color information is now preserved. This reduces the need for re-coloring in other CAD software and ensures smooth data integration.

### 'Median' Extraction for Point Cloud Sections (Noise Reduction)
A new function extracts the 'Median' from point cloud vertical sections. This automatically reduces noise from heavy machinery or vegetation, making it easier to trace the actual outlines of structures.

## About KOLC+
KOLC+ is a BIM/CIM cloud platform for integrating and sharing models and point clouds. It is used by over 500 companies and is certified as an information sharing system (ASP) and subsidy-eligible software by the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ism (MLIT).
